- Synopsis:
-
Protocols, access management, cryptography role, distributed systems, multilevel security, multilateral security, banking and accounting systems, monitoring systems, control and command, security imprint and seals, biometry, physical security, emission security. Electronic information warfare. Net attacks and protection. Commercial system protection. Privacy protection. E - policy. Management instruments. System development and evaluation. Security standards.
